Season Adventures Abound has arrived in Pokemon GO in September 2023 to replace Season Hidden Gems. The surprise that appeared in this season was the release of the ninth Generation Pokemon Paldea Region.
Unexpectedly, instead of the 8th generation starter that was released first, namely the Galar region, the Paldea Region was the first to appear. On September 5, 2023, the Pokemon that will be released from the Paldea Region are Sprigatito (can be evolved to Floragato & Meowscarada), Fuecoco (Crocalor & Skeledirge), Quaxly (Quaxwell & Quaquaval), and Lechonk (Oinkologne (male) & Oinkologne (female)). Collect as much candy from these pokemons so that you can evolve them.
You need to know that for Lechonk, a shiny version will be released immediately in Pokemon GO. It's time to hunt for Lechonk in order to get the male and female shiny form so they can complete it in your shiny pokedex.
Complete the timed quests during the event as they will be rewarded with Lechonk. There is also special research with different paths, depending on the Paldea starter partner you choose. The new Pokemon Paldea is also available as a reward from quests at Pokestops.
At this event the Pokemon that will appear a lot are Sprigatito, Fuecoco, Quaxly, Lechonk. Hoppip, Houndour, Buizel, and Fletchling. Hoppip, Houndour, Buizel, and Fletchling will have an increased chance of getting their shiny form during this event, which is from 5-10 September 2023.
You can also get the new Pokemon Paldea from the 7km egg you get from opening gifts. In Raid battle tier 1 there will be Unown pokemon with variations of the letters P, A, L, D, E from the word Paldea. If you're lucky, you can get the shiny. For Raid battle tier 5, Pokemon Ultra Beasts Kartana (in the northern hemisphere) and Celesteela (southern hemisphere) will appear. But the two of them will exchange appearances on September 8-16 2023.
The event bonus that you can enjoy during this event is 4x the XP and stardust for catching Pokemon. This bonus is certainly very large when compared to other events.
Take advantage by using Lucky Egg and Starpiece items. With Lucky Egg, once you catch a Pokemon you get 8x the XP, and with starpiece it gets 6x the stardust.
